讓ChatGPT使用BuildRowSetFromJSON來創建行集
目錄
概述
在本文中,我們將介紹如何使用建立行集從Json和腳本函數在Salesforce Marketing Cloud中創建行數據集。我們將從基本概念開始,逐步深入介紹使用Json和腳本函數建立行集的過程。我們還將探討不同的用例和示例,以幫助您更好地理解這些概念。
介紹表格
在Salesforce Marketing Cloud中,建立行集從Json和腳本函數是一種強大的功能,可以幫助您處理和操作數據。該函數可以從Json字符串中創建行集,並根據需要獲取特定數據。
使用Json和腳本函數建立行集
在Salesforce Marketing Cloud中使用建立行集從Json和腳本函數非常簡單。您只需要提供一個Json字符串和一個行集名稱,該函數將自動解析Json字符串並創建相應的行集。
Set @JsonString = '{"employee":[{"name":"John","email":"john@example.com"},{"name":"Jane","email":"jane@example.com"}]}'
Set @RowSetName = 'EmployeeRowSet'
Set @RowCount = BuildRowSetFromJson(@JsonString, @RowSetName, "employee")
上述示例代碼將從Json字符串創建一個行集,並命名為"EmployeeRowSet"。該Json字符串包含一個名為"employee"的數組,其中包含兩個員工的姓名和電子郵件。
在Content Builder中嘗試使用建立行集腳本
要在Content Builder中嘗試使用建立行集從Json和腳本函數,首先需要將代碼粘貼到Cloud頁面中。然後,您可以保存和運行該代碼以查看結果。
Json路徑語法
在使用建立行集從Json和腳本函數時,您需要提供一個Json路徑表達式來指定要檢索的數據。這個Json路徑表達式遵循特定的語法規則,以幫助您準確地定位到所需的數據。
Json行集的操作
一旦您使用建立行集從Json和腳本函數創建了一個行集,您可以執行各種操作來處理和操作該行集。您可以使用內置函數和方法創建、查找、修改和刪除行集中的數據。
為行集指定確切地址
如果您的Json字符串包含多個數組或對象,您可以使用特定的Json路徑表達式來指定行集的確切地址。這將幫助您準確地從Json字符串中檢索所需的數據。
檢查行集的行數
在使用建立行集從Json和腳本函數時,您可以使用內置函數檢查行集中的行數。這將幫助您確定行集是否包含所需的數據,以及它的大小。
使用字段和行函數訪問行集數據
一旦您創建了一個行集,您可以使用字段和行函數來訪問該行集中的數據。這些函數將幫助您從行集中檢索特定的數據字段。
創建包含多列和多行的HTML表格
您可以使用建立行集從Json和腳本函數創建包含多列和多行的HTML表格。您可以指定表格中的列數和行數,並將行集中的數據填充到表格中。
重新訓練ChatGPT使用建立行集腳本
如果ChatGPT無法完全理解和使用建立行集從Json和腳本函數,您可以使用重新訓練的方法來幫助它更好地理解這些概念。通過提供相關的代碼示例和指導,您可以改善ChatGPT對於這些功能的使用。
謝謝觀看今天的視頻,希望您在其中找到了樂趣和收穫。如果您有任何問題,請在下方留言,並給視頻一個大拇指,不要忘記訂閱頻道,以便在我發布更多Salesforce Marketing Cloud相關內容時收到通知。
亮點
- 在Salesforce Marketing Cloud中使用Json和腳本函數建立行集
- 解析Json字符串並創建相應的行集
- 在Content Builder中測試和運行建立行集腳本
- 使用Json路徑表達式定位到所需的數據
- 處理和操作建立的Json行集
- 檢查行集的行數和字段的值
- 創建包含多列和多行的HTML表格
- 重新訓練ChatGPT以改進對建立行集腳本的理解
常見問題解答
問題:如何使用建立行集從Json和腳本函數創建行集?
答案:只需提供Json字符串和行集名稱,然後調用BuildRowSetFromJson函數即可。
問題:可以在Content Builder中測試和運行建立行集腳本嗎?
答案:是的,您可以在Content Builder的Cloud頁面中粘貼腳本代碼並運行它。
問題:如何訪問行集中的特定數據字段?
答案:您可以使用字段函數和行函數來訪問行集中的數據字段。
資源